Uttarakhand Sports Department Requires Over 2,000 Volunteers for National Games
Dehradun, December 18, 2024:
In preparation for the 38th National Games, the Uttarakhand Sports Department has initiated the volunteer registration process. Approximately 2,000–2,500 volunteers are needed for this grand event. Since the launch of the mascot and other symbols, over 10,000 volunteers have already registered.

Preparations for the Event
The CEO of the National Games Secretariat, Amit Sinha, emphasized that everyone’s cooperation is being sought to ensure the event’s success. Volunteers will play a crucial role in the successful execution of this large-scale event.
Additional CEO Prashant Arya mentioned that registrations are coming not only from Uttarakhand but also from states like Uttar Pradesh, Maharashtra, and others. Several retired officers have also expressed interest in volunteering.
Volunteer Registration Process
- Registration Website: 38nguk.in
- Age Requirement: 18 years or above
- Selection Options:
- Background in sports
- General category
After registration, participants will receive an e-certificate. Selected volunteers will also receive a separate certificate for the 2025 National Games.
Training and Deployment
- Volunteers will be provided necessary training by the Sports Department.
- They will be assigned to various roles, including sports events, parking, and other arrangements.
